> That's what it sounds like. To test, create a script with sgid and
> see if indeed it works eg
> echo "#!/bin/sh">/home/sites/mytest

when i try to do this i get the following error

[portal portal]$ echo "#!/bin/sh">/home/sites/www.afser.de/users/ 
portal/mytest
bash: !/bin/sh": event not found

I did

[portal portal]$ echo "/bin/sh">/home/sites/www.afser.de/users/portal/ 
mytest
instead, but is this what i was supposed to do?


> echo "touch /tmp/myfile">>/home/sites/mytest
> chgrp mailman /home/sites/mytest
> chmod 2755 /home/sites/mytest
>
> /home/sites/mytest
>
> and see if  /tmp/myfile gets a group ownership of mailman





>
> I suspect you may have probs with this if you don't have root on  
> the machine
> which may be the initial problem. Can you
>
> chgrp  mailman /home/sites/www.afser.de/users/portal/mailman
> chmod 2755 /home/sites/www.afser.de/users/portal/mailman

I am able to do this (chgrp and chgrp)
